About Us
We are an approved Training practice with all 4 of our Partners being Trainers – Dr Michael Merriman, Dr Mohan Segarajasinghe, Dr Gillian West & Dr Andrew Fisher.
Our practice ethos is that we are committed to providing first class primary care in a challenging environment. We are also committed to the ongoing development of individuals and teams. We like to put patients first and we feel we are a warm and welcoming practice.
The practice values skill mix and our clinical team consists of four Partners, Salaried GPs, Advanced Nurse Practitioners, Practice Nurses, Health Care Assistants, Pharmacists and Phlebotomist. We also house ARRS staff (Additional Roles Reimbursement Scheme) – Mental Health Practitioners, Macmillan Navigator, Physiotherapists, Social Prescriber Link Workers and APP (Associate Psychological Practitioner).
The EMIS Web clinical system is used at the practice and we have achieved Paperlight Accreditation.
We hold regular Practice and Clinical Meetings and have allocated time set aside for Practice/Professional Development. We have a study based at the main surgery which holds the most essential of the ‘Registrar’ texts and journals/magazines. There is also internet access via NHS Wifi.
Both practices have iPads on the front desks to facilitate patients requiring language translation. Patients can simply speak into the iPad which will then translate the detected language (subject to language).
